Meeting on Fishery : Norway’s Ambassador met Vietnam’s Minister

Grete Løchen, the Ambassador of Norway to Vietnam, had a meeting with Nguyen Xuan Cuong, Minister of Agriculture and Rural Development of Vietnam on Tuesday, 19 March 2019.

The Ambassador underlined effective bilateral relations between Vietnam and Norway over the past 30 years since it began in the early 1970s. She also affirmed that Norway’s government intended to continually promote bilateral relations with Vietnam especially in the field of fishery and marine resources.

“Norway and the Norwegian companies are willing to share experiences, expertise and technologies with Vietnam to develop a marine aquaculture industry in a sustainable way” said the Ambassador.

Agreeing with Grete Lochen, Nguyen Xuan Cuong said “Norway is a power in the marine aquaculture area, and Vietnam sees Norway as a strategic partner in the implementation of its National Marine Aquaculture Strategy.”

But there are a lot of works that need to do to enhance the strategy between two sides, he added.

In near future, Norway and Vietnam will have another meeting to discuss and assure that Vietnam is ready to attend the Aqua Nor, Seafood Trade Fair, that will be held in Norway in August 2019.
